Take a look at sendmail and postfix. Both offer a virtual
user feature via what they refer to as a "virtusertable". This
allows you to map same_name at different_domains to different system user
names so they can be delivered properly. I.E., john at domain1.com would
get delivered to a user name named "john1" (or whatever) and
john at domain2.com would be deliver to the mailbox of user john2. Make
sense?
